Bachelor Party in Jaisalmer: 7-Day Itinerary

Friday, October 27: Arrival and First Night in Jaisalmer

Start your bachelor party adventure in Jaisalmer, the golden city of Rajasthan. After arriving at Jaisalmer Airport, check-in at your preferred hotel and freshen up. In the evening, head to Gadisar Lake, a serene lake surrounded by temples and ghats. Enjoy a peaceful boat ride and take in the picturesque sunset views. Later, explore the vibrant streets of the Jaisalmer Fort area and indulge in delicious local cuisine.

  • Gadisar Lake: INR 100, 1-2 hours
  • Jaisalmer Fort: Free entry, 2-3 hours
  • Dinner at a local restaurant: INR 500-800 per person
Saturday, October 28: Desert Safari and Bonfire Night

Embark on an exciting desert safari and experience the thrill of dune bashing in the Sam Sand Dunes. Enjoy camel rides through the golden sands and witness mesmerizing folk performances by local artists. As the night falls, gather around a bonfire for a memorable evening of music, dance, and traditional Rajasthani cuisine.

  • Desert Safari (including camel ride): INR 1500-2000 per person, 4-6 hours
  • Evening entertainment and dinner in the desert: INR 1000-1500 per person
Sunday, October 29: Historical Exploration

Delve into the rich history of Jaisalmer by visiting its architectural marvels. Start your day with a visit to Patwon Ki Haveli, a cluster of intricately carved mansions showcasing exquisite Rajasthani craftsmanship. Then, explore the stunning Jain Temples known for their intricate sculptures. End the day by enjoying a mesmerizing sunset view from the Bada Bagh cenotaphs.

  • Patwon Ki Haveli: INR 100, 1-2 hours
  • Jain Temples: INR 50, 1-2 hours
  • Bada Bagh: INR 100, 1-2 hours
Monday, October 30: Adventure and Adrenaline

Get your adrenaline pumping by indulging in adventurous activities around Jaisalmer. Start with a thrilling quad biking session in the desert, followed by paragliding for panoramic views of the city and its surroundings. In the evening, visit Kuldhara, an abandoned haunted village with a fascinating history.

  • Quad Biking: INR 1500-2000 per person, 2-3 hours
  • Paragliding: INR 3000-4000 per person, 1-2 hours
  • Kuldhara Village: INR 200, 1-2 hours
Tuesday, October 31: Shopping and Spa Day

Take a relaxing break from adventure and spend the day indulging in some retail therapy and rejuvenation. Explore the bustling Sadar Bazaar, known for its vibrant handicrafts, textiles, and jewelry. Treat yourself to a luxurious spa session, where you can unwind and pamper yourself with traditional Ayurvedic treatments.

  • Sadar Bazaar Shopping: Cost varies, 2-4 hours
  • Spa Session: INR 2000-3000 per person, 2-3 hours
Wednesday, November 1: Cultural Immersion

Immerse yourself in the rich cultural heritage of Jaisalmer by participating in traditional activities. Start your day with a cooking class, where you can learn to prepare authentic Rajasthani dishes. Afterward, visit a local village to witness rural life and interact with the friendly locals. In the evening, attend a mesmerizing folk dance and music performance.

  • Cooking Class: INR 1000-1500 per person, 2-3 hours
  • Local Village Visit: INR 500-800 per person, 2-3 hours
  • Folk Dance and Music Show: INR 300-500 per person, 1-2 hours
Thursday, November 2: Farewell and Departure

On the final day of your bachelor party in Jaisalmer, bid farewell to the city. Enjoy a leisurely breakfast at your hotel and take some time to explore the local markets for souvenirs. Depart from Jaisalmer Airport with unforgettable memories of your adventurous and culturally immersive trip.

  • Breakfast at the hotel: INR 200-500 per person
  • Shopping for souvenirs: Cost varies

Hidden Gems and Local Favorites

For an off-the-beaten-path experience, venture out to the Kuldhara Ruins, located near Jaisalmer. This abandoned village is believed to be haunted and offers a unique glimpse into the region's history. Additionally, consider visiting the Thar Heritage Museum, which showcases a diverse collection of artifacts representing the vibrant culture of Rajasthan. These hidden gems will add a touch of mystery and local charm to your bachelor party itinerary in Jaisalmer.
